I think Slash is something people either get or not get. I'm not sure I'd ever be motivated to provide a logical explanation to its appeal - because I'm not sure that there is a logical basis to it.

And I I have to, I'd say it has much more to do with the branch of creativity the readers and writers had had and/or embraced than their view on sex and romance. Of the people I've met here, the latter differs widely, but the one thing that is for sure, that unites us is our ability and love to use a fictional world and characters built up in media as a foundation of a hypothetical world, and build something upon it by more or less following the guidelines that are provided by canon. It's ... rather like building a hypothesis upon a hypothesis, and many people do not find appeal in even the first hypothesis alone. It doesn't mean they're wrong or less in any way, it's just ... their thinking is wired differently. :)
